sulbactam

Sulbactam is a beta-lactamase inhibitor similar in structure to clavulanate. It may be administered orally or parenterally along with a beta-lactam antibiotic. It is combined with ampicillin for IM/IV use in ampicillin sulbactam (Unasyn).
